Once a part of the fortification of the city towards the lake, these days the Bauschänzli peninsula makes itself useful as a beer garden. Get a big beer (ein Grosses) at the self-service counter and a bratwurst (veal sausage) with potato salad and enjoy the shade of the big old trees (where they are still standing) and the view over the river. There is a resident band that plays hit music (15:00 - 17:00, 19:00 - 22:30) for the mostly fifty-plus guests who hit the dance floor and an area with service, where not only the food but also the prices are more sophisticated. Brass bands for the morning pint on Sunday mornings.
(Self Service: 13 - 38Sfr, served area: 29 - 65Sfr)
